Passenger plane lands safely

A commercial airliner, which had just left the Pierre Regional
Airport, had to make an emergency return early Sunday morning after
one of its engines failed.

Officials say the Mesaba Airlines plane, which was headed to Watertown
and then Minneapolis, had left the airport shortly after 7 a.m. Cory
Hoffrogge, coordinator of the Pierre Airport Fire and Rescue Squad,
says the pilot reported a few minutes later that an engine had failed
and that the plane was returning to Pierre.

Hoffrogge says it is standard procedure that when one engine fails,
the plane must return to the airport. The plane landed about 10-15
minutes later without incident.

Pierre Police Office Leasa McFarling says law enforcement, fire and
ambulance crews were dispatched to the airport as a precaution.

A handful of passengers, who had been on board, left the plane. The
flight was canceled.
